Games Workshop Group PLC reported a significant increase in revenue for the six months to December 2, 2018, reaching £125.2 million, up from £109.6 million in the same period last year.
02
Operating profit and pre-tax profit also saw growth, rising to £40.8 million for the six months to December 2, 2018, compared to £38.1 million in the prior year.
03
Basic earnings per share increased to 100.8p from 96.0p, and the dividend per share declared in the period rose to 65p from 61p.
04
Trade segment revenue experienced substantial growth, increasing from £48.0 million to £61.4 million, while Retail revenue grew from £39.6 million to £42.6 million.
05
Cash generated from operations decreased to £36.0 million from £41.2 million, primarily due to increased investment in working capital.
06
The company's return on capital declined from 119% in November 2017 to 96% in November 2018, attributed to increased investment in capacity and working capital.
07
Games Workshop expanded its retail presence by opening 23 new stores (net 507 total stores) and increased its trade accounts by approximately 300, contributing to sales growth across all key territories except Australia and New Zealand for retail.
